When Everything Feels Unstructured

When struggling practice

Create one temporary container when the whole day or situation feels too shapeless to navigate.

Time
10 minutes
Use it when
You cannot see a sequence, every task feels equally present, or the environment is increasing confusion.
Often supports
Architect and Vessel

The practice

  1. Name the next hour rather than the whole day.
  2. Choose one place to be and one category of activity.
  3. Write three boundaries: what begins, what is outside this hour, and what marks the end.
  4. Take the first action inside that container, then review when the hour ends.

Adapt it

Use fifteen minutes, one room, or one page. Ask someone to help name the boundary if doing so alone is difficult.

Stop if

The structure ignores food, rest, medication, safety, caregiving, or another immediate need. Basic conditions belong inside the plan.
